Ingredients:
4 medium potatoes peeled ( I used 7)
1 tbsp oil
3 tbsps grated parmesan cheese
2 tbsps chopped fresh parsley or 2 tsps dried parsley
1 tsp paprika
1/2 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p salt
1/8 tsp cayenne pepper
Directions:
Preheat oven to 450 degrees. Line a baking sheet with aluminun foil and spray with cooking spray. Slice potatoes in half, then cut into 1/2 inch cubes.
Place potatoes in a medium bowl and toss with oil. Combine parmesan, parsley, paprika, garlic powder, salt and cayenne pepper in a small bowl.
Add the parmesan mixture to potatoes; toss to coat potatoes evenly.
Arrange potatoes on prepared baking sheet. Bake, turning once, until potatoes are lightly browned and easily pierced with a knife about 25 minutes.
Beet-Corn-Asparagus Medley
I made this vegetables to go along with my potatoes and baked tilapia. I call it " Beet-Corn-Asparagus Medley"
Ingredients:
1 Large beet diced
1 cup cut asparagus
1cup corn
1 Medium red onion diced
some cut leeks (optional)
2 cloves of garlic chopped
2 tbsp olive oil
2 tbsp of warm water
Salt & pepper (to taste)
Directions:
In a skillet, on medium heat, add the olive oil and the onions, the garlic and the leeks. Add the beet along with the asparagus,let it simmer and cook for a few minutes. Add the corn, salt and pepper and the warm water, let simmer for 3-5 minutes and serve.
